#ba1cbc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ba1cbc is composed of 72.9% red, 11%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.1% cyan, 85.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 299.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#ba1cbc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38ff with #750079.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

● #ba1cbc color description : Strong magenta.
#ba1cbc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ba1cbc has RGB values of R:186, G:28,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12197052.

Shades and Tints of #ba1cbc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fceef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ba1cbc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716771 is the less saturated color, while #d203d5 is the most saturated one.
